QString databaseType;booltestOnBorrow;// 取得连接的时候验证连接是否有效QString testOnBorrowSql;// 测试访问数据库的 SQLintmaxWaitTime;// 获取连接最大等待时间intwaitInterval;// 尝试获取连接时等待间隔时间intmaxConnectionCount;// 最大连接数staticQMutex mutex;staticQWaitCondition waitConnection;staticCon...
51CTO博客已为您找到关于sqlite qt 数据库多线程连接池的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及sqlite qt 数据库多线程连接池问答内容。更多sqlite qt 数据库多线程连接池相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
QStringtestOnBorrowSql;//测试访问数据库的 SQL intmaxWaitTime;//获取连接最大等待时间 intwaitInterval;//尝试获取连接时等待间隔时间 intmaxConnectionCount;//最大连接数 QQueue<QString>usedConnectionNames;//已使用的数据库连接名 QQueue<QString>unUsedConnectionNames;//未使用的数据库连接名 staticQMutexmute...
为了解决这个问题,我们可以使用数据库连接池(Database Connection Pool)来管理我们的数据库连接。数据库连接池是一种存储多个预先建立的数据库连接的技术,这些连接可以被应用程序重复使用,而不需要每次都需要创建新的连接。这样可以大大减少数据库连接的创建和销毁开销,提高应用程序的性能。在Qt中,我们可以使用QSqlDatabas...
连接池(Connection Pool)是一种用于管理数据库连接的技术,旨在提高数据库的访问性能和资源利用率。Qt是一个跨平台的C++应用程序开发框架,提供了访问数据库的模块Qt SQL,可以轻松实现与MySQL数据库的连接和数据操作。 要使用Qt连接MySQL数据库连接池,可以按照以下步骤进行: ...
qt登陆验证,c++服务器数据库连接池 加 线程池分压。, 视频播放量 4845、弹幕量 0、点赞数 79、投硬币枚数 29、收藏人数 199、转发人数 8, 视频作者 中考389上职高, 作者简介 ,相关视频:QT登录界面,基于开源项目修改,只做了微调整,自定义边框,全局拖动,Qt中多线程-线
在Qt中连接MySQL数据库并使用连接池可以通过以下步骤完成: 1. 首先,确保你已经安装了MySQL数据库,并且有相关的账号和密码。 2. 在Qt项目中,添加MySQL驱动。在.pro文件中添加...
1.带领您深入学习QT5/C++:Qt多线程线程池及数据同步机制 ,多线程文件下载器项目实战,继承自QThread,继承自QObject,QRunnable和QThreadPool,QtConcurrent,Qt多线程技术与数据加锁保护机制:QMutex,QSemaphore,QReadWriteLock,QWaitCondition;Qt线程池技术、Qt数据库连接池、等。
支持多客户端链接的 tcp服务器,数据封包处理,外加SQL 连接池 TCP server sql server2018-11-14 上传大小:40KB 所需:43积分/C币 Qt 多线程连接数据库——数据库连接池 * 数据库连接池特点: * 获取连接时不需要了解连接的名字,连接池内部维护连接的名字 * 支持多线程,保证获取到的连接一定是没有被其他线程正...
华为云帮助中心为你分享云计算行业信息,包含产品介绍、用户指南、开发指南、最佳实践和常见问题等文档,方便快速查找定位问题与能力成长,并提供相关资料和解决方案。本页面关键词:qt实现mysql数据库连接池。